This connection reinforces the thematic and narrative continuity of the Mara's corruption spreading through Aris. The earlier event establishes Aris's unnatural acquisition of speech as a sign of the Mara's influence, and this is explicitly called back in Episode 12 through Tegan's dream narrative, which the Doctor uses to deduce the Mara's entry point into this world.
